Your best friend passes you in the school hallway and glares at you without speaking. You think, Now, why did she do that? One p

ossible explanation could be that she saw you flirting with her boyfriend. Within the framework of the scientific method, that possible explanation for your friends behavior would be considered a(n)__________, which will remain tentative until it has been tested.
Health
1 answer:
Talja [164]4 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Hypothesis

Explanation:

Hypothesis is more than a wild guess but less than an established evidence.

Here you have no evidence why. your friend snubbed you so it's still a hypothesis.
